Big Deal: Plush Reversible Cat-Duck at MOMA

Posted by Erin Behan

 

I'm a sucker for anything animal-related that sparks kids' imaginations, so it's no surprise that this reversible toy (now it's a cat, now it's a duck, now it's a cat again) gets my irresponsible internet shopping buttons going. Bonus points: It's made in Berlin--what a cool mom/dad you are buying toys made by uber-hipsters in Berlin! But, best of all, it's on sale at the MOMA store for $69.95 (down from $95).
